GIS Solutions Architect - ArcGIS
6 months rolling/Worthing but hybrid working/£720 per day (Inside IR35)
A leading technology strong professional services company seek an experienced GIS Solutions Architect - ArcGIS to form part of the Operational Asset Management delivery programme that is refreshing the companies Work and Asset Management capabilities. They are replacing its Legacy Work and Asset Management applications with IBM Maximo (Maximo Application Suite) and ESRI ArcGIS.
The role will help the business migrate from Legacy systems, understand how these systems will be decommissioned following migration. The business has an expectation that once they are operating on the new platforms the architect will help them deploy additional platform features to allow them to automate more of the work and asset management function and leverage the capabilities of the mew platforms that are being deployed.
